Turkish Windmill-
There is a lot of buzz around the term "training the core" in the fitness world these days.  But what does it mean? How do you do it? These two exercises and the combinations in the segment will build serious core strength along with shoulder stability and coordination.

Tips for mastering the Bent Press that will shave time off your learning curve and have you doing the bent press the RIGHT way (not a side press with excessive lean) in MINUTES not days.

Two hands anyhow-A favorite of old-time strongmen like Saxon and Sandow, the two-hands anyhow is a total-body study in flexibility, coordination and strength.
